On Fri, 13 May 2011 16:02:32 -0400 (EDT)
David Miller <davem@davemloft.net> wrote:

> From: Eric Dumazet <eric.dumazet@gmail.com>
> Date: Fri, 13 May 2011 22:00:44 +0200
> 
> > Le vendredi 13 mai 2011 à 12:53 -0700, Stephen Hemminger a écrit :
> >> The commit 6b1e960fdbd75dcd9bcc3ba5ff8898ff1ad30b6e
> >>     bridge: Reset IPCB when entering IP stack on NF_FORWARD
> >> broke forwarding of IPV6 packets in bridge because it would
> >> call bp_parse_ip_options with an IPV6 packet.
> >> 
> >> Reported-by: Noah Meyerhans <noahm@debian.org>
> >> Signed-off-by: Stephen Hemminger <shemminger@vyatta.com>
> >> 
> >> ---
> >> Patch against net-next-2.6 but must be applied to net-2.6
> >> and stable as well
> >> 
> > 
> > Well, stable is not needed, since faulty commit is not in 2.6.38
> > 
> > Reviewed-by: Eric Dumazet <eric.dumazet@gmail.com>
> 
> I do need to queue it up for -stable because the faulty commit is
> also queued up there :-)

The faulty commit was in 2.6.38.4
